Lymphoepithelioma-like carcinoma of the duodenum: a very infrequent tumor

Resumen
Lymphoepithelioma-like carcinoma (LELC) is a type of tumor that is histologically characterized by wide lymphoplasmacytic infiltration in the stroma. This type of carcinoma is usually found in the airway and is extremely infrequent in the gastrointestinal tract. We present the case of a 77-year-old male, under follow-up for refractory anemia, who was diagnosed with a cavum type lymphoepithelioma-like carcinoma in the third duodenal portion. After diagnosis, he was treated surgically via a duodenal resection, without adjuvant oncological treatment due to the early diagnosis and surgical pathology features. Today, 12 months after surgery, the patient is free of disease. Cases of LELC have been described in other organs of the gastrointestinal tract. However, after an extensive review of the literature, this is the first case of LELC in the duodenum. A review of the available literature about LELC in the digestive tract and its management was also included.
